Skip to content

[WIP] Use OAMData struct#699

Draft
CT075 wants to merge 7 commits intoFireEmblemUniverse:masterfrom
CT075:use-oamdata
Draft

[WIP] Use OAMData struct#699
CT075 wants to merge 7 commits intoFireEmblemUniverse:masterfrom
CT075:use-oamdata

Conversation

@CT075
Copy link
Member

@CT075 CT075 commented Mar 12, 2025

This is an ongoing effort to replace OAM configurations with semantic values instead of just contextless u16 arrays.

Would appreciate opinions from @Eebit and @MokhaLeee as to whether this is worth completing. I think it makes it much easier to see what any given rendering call is doing, but it does lead to some messy moments.

I think the bmio.c is probably the best example of what this would look like.

CT075 added 5 commits March 11, 2025 09:07
Signed-off-by: Cameron Wong <cam@camdar.io>
Signed-off-by: Cameron Wong <cam@camdar.io>
Signed-off-by: Cameron Wong <cam@camdar.io>
Signed-off-by: Cameron Wong <cam@camdar.io>
Signed-off-by: Cameron Wong <cam@camdar.io>
@CT075 CT075 marked this pull request as draft March 12, 2025 11:30
CT075 added 2 commits March 12, 2025 07:36
Signed-off-by: Cameron Wong <cam@camdar.io>
Signed-off-by: Cameron Wong <cam@camdar.io>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ant